Syslinux: A Powerful Bootloader for Linux Systems
Introduction:
Syslinux, an open-source bootloader, is widely used in Linux-based systems to load and boot the operating system. It offers a simple and efficient solution for initializing the system and managing the booting process. This article explores the features and capabilities of Syslinux and its significance in Linux distributions.
Overview and Features:
Syslinux stands for \"System Linux\" and provides a collection of lightweight bootloaders for Linux distributions. It is designed to run on any FAT16 or FAT32 filesystem, making it compatible with a wide range of storage devices. Syslinux allows users to boot Linux kernels directly from CDs, USB drives, floppy disks, or network shares.
One of the key features of Syslinux is its support for various filesystems, including FAT, NTFS, ext2, ext3, ext4, and ISO9660. This versatility ensures that Syslinux can be used on different storage media, enabling users to boot their systems from various sources effortlessly.
Advantages of Using Syslinux:
1. Flexibility: Syslinux provides flexibility by allowing users to boot Linux from different storage devices. It supports both BIOS and UEFI systems, making it compatible with a wide range of hardware configurations.
2. Easy to Use and Configure: Syslinux has a simple configuration format, written in plain text, making it easy for users to modify the bootloader settings. It provides extensive documentation, making it easy to understand and configure.
3. Lightweight and Fast: Syslinux is known for its lightweight design and fast booting time. It occupies minimal space on the boot media and loads the operating system quickly, enhancing the overall system performance.
Use Cases of Syslinux:
1. Live CDs and Installers: Syslinux is often used in Live CDs and installers to facilitate easy booting and installation of Linux-based operating systems. It allows users to launch a complete operating system directly from a CD or DVD without the need for installation on the hard drive.
2. Embedded Systems: Syslinux is commonly utilized in embedded systems where space and resources are limited. Its small footprint and efficient booting process make it an ideal choice for devices like routers, network switches, and other embedded devices.
3. USB Boot Drives: Syslinux enables users to create bootable USB drives to run Linux distributions without installing them on their machines. This is particularly useful for testing new Linux releases, performing system recovery tasks, or creating portable Linux environments.
